## Canary Gating Tuning

The Wrenfield deploy pipeline promotes a canary only when every gating rule passes for the full observation window. As a contractor, please do not loosen these thresholds to unblock a release; raise it with the platform rotation instead. Each value was set after the Q3 rollback review, and changing one usually requires adjusting the others. The current gating constants are:

limits module of tafof-kagef:
RATE_LIMITS = {
    "zorix": 10,
    "ralath": 1,
    "quenwyn": 2,
    "holael": 10,
}

Facilities ticket — Halewick Tower, night shift.

Issue: support team reporting east stairwell reader rejecting badges after midnight. Reader was reset this morning; firmware updated. Overnight crew should now badge as normal. If the reader fails again, use the manual keypad by the fire door — do not prop the door. Log any further failures with the time and badge name. Temporary keypad code for the fallback door is below.

door code, tajeg-fawip: bdg-K-62

Subject: Partner SFTP drop — new owner

Hi,

As you review the pending changes to the Harborline ingest scripts, note that ownership of the partner SFTP drop is changing at the end of the month. This includes key rotation, the nightly pull job, and the quarantine folder for malformed files. Review comments on the retry logic should still go through the normal PR flow, but questions about drop-folder conventions or partner onboarding now go to the new owner. The incoming owner is listed below.

signatory, tagaf-bahaf: Praael Fenmir Rusok